**New Starter Checklist — Spare Hardware Room (Reception)**

Show new starters the spare hardware room on Level 1, behind the mail alcove at Fenwick Place. Keyboards, mice, and headsets live on the left shelving; log anything taken in the blue binder. The door keypad accepts the code below.

turnstile pass: bdg-FVNQRS-72965873

## Environment Variables — ChipGate Reader

The ChipGate timing-chip reader service used at Larkspur Marathon events is configured entirely through its env file; no values are hardcoded. `CHIPGATE_PORT` and `CHIPGATE_ANTENNA_COUNT` control hardware polling, while results are streamed to the Finishline aggregation service over mutual TLS. Reviewers should verify that every variable added here is documented and that secrets are sourced from the vault sync job, never committed. The aggregation service's client secret is set on the following line.

vault entry, kafog-yahop: COURIER_KEY8=0faa53ae

Release checklist — Murmur Guide 3.2 (Hallenford Museum pilot). Plugin authors: confirm your exhibit packs declare a schema version of 4 or higher, as legacy manifests will be rejected at install time starting with this release. Audio assets must be pre-transcoded to Opus; the on-device transcoder has been removed. Test your pack against the staging gallery map, not production, since room identifiers changed in the Hallenford east wing. When filing compatibility reports, quote the build token that appears immediately below.

pipeline stamp: htk9_ce63042d9

**Alert: LB health check failures — Quillwave edge pool**

Hey, welcome aboard! This alert fires when more than two nodes behind the Pelora load balancer fail three consecutive health checks. Usually it's a slow deploy on the Quillwave API tier, not an actual outage — traffic just shifts to healthy nodes. Check the deploy channel first, then the node dashboards. If half the pool is red, that's real. Questions go to the platform crew at the address below.

pager mailbox: druwyn@norvaio.corp